the performance identity that helped define the GTO name. The
Pontiac Tempest served as the midsize foundation for the GTO, which
originated as a performance option package before becoming its own
model. The 1965 model year represents an important period in
Pontiac history, as the GTO played a key role in shaping the
American muscle car segment. The GTO stood out from the regular
Tempest with heavy-duty suspension for improved handling, quad
stacked headlights, a hood scoop, GTO badging, and sporty trim.
Inside, bucket seats, a center console, and sporty gauges
contributed to a driver-focused, performance-oriented experience.
